Abstract
We have investigated the expression and cellular localization of ciliary ne urotrophic factor (CNTF) in the rat retina following optic nerve transectio n. In the normal retina, CNTF immunoreactivity was restricted to profiles i n the ganglion cell layer. Following optic nerve transection, immunoreactiv ity appeared in Muller cell somata and processes and its intensity increase d between three and seven days post-lesion. Quantitative evaluation by immu noblotting confirmed that CNTF expression increased continuously up to 7 da ys after optic nerve transection (to 430% of control levels), but decreased again to 250% of controls at 4 weeks post-lesion. Our findings suggest tha t CNTF supplied by Muller cells may play a protective role for axotomized g anglion cells in the rat retina. (C) 2000 Elsevier Science B.V. All rights reserved.
